Freescale MCF51AC128CCLKE

Freescale MCF51AC128CCLKE
Артикул: 404809

Требуется установка или ремонт?

сервисный центр Kypidetali!

тел. +7(499)347-04-82

Описание Freescale MCF51AC128CCLKE

Отличный выбор! Freescale MCF51AC128CCLKE — это 8-битный микроконтроллер из семейства ColdFire V1, которое позже стало частью линейки Kinetis EA (а затем и Kinetis L) от NXP после поглощения Freescale. Этот МК сочетает в себе ядро ColdFire с периферией, характерной для 8-битных микроконтроллеров, что делает его мощным решением для встраиваемых систем.

Вот подробное описание, характеристики и информация о совместимости.

Общее описание

Микроконтроллер MCF51AC128CCLKE построен на высокоэффективном 32-битном ядре ColdFire V1, работающем на частоте до 50.33 МГц. Несмотря на 32-битное ядро, он позиционируется как 8/16-битный МК благодаря своей архитектуре, оптимизированной для замены классических 8-битных устройств с существенным приростом производительности. Он предназначен для применений, требующих высокой вычислительной мощности, богатой периферии и низкого энергопотребления: промышленная автоматизация, системы управления электродвигателями, бытовая техника, охранные системы и сложные потребительские устройства.


Ключевые технические характеристики

1. Ядро и производительность:

  • Архитектура: 32-битное ядро Freescale ColdFire V1.
  • Тактовая частота: До 50.33 МГц.
  • Производительность: До ~50 Dhrystone MIPS.
  • Флеш-память: 128 КБ.
  • ОЗУ (RAM): 8 КБ.

2. Периферия и интерфейсы:

  • Таймеры:
    • 2x 16-битных таймера (TPM): Каждый с поддержкой ШИМ (PWM), захвата/сравнения и счетчика.
    • Модуль периодического прерывания (PIT).
    • Сторожевой таймер (COP).
  • Аналоговые интерфейсы:
    • АЦП (ADC): 12-битный, до 16 каналов, скорость конверсии до 1.5 Мвыб/с.
  • Коммуникационные интерфейсы:
    • 2x UART (SCI): С поддержкой LIN.
    • Модуль SPI.
    • Модуль I²C.
  • Системные функции:
    • Модуль генерации тактовых сигналов (CGM): Поддержка внешнего кварца, внутреннего генератора.
    • Контроллер прерываний (INTC).
    • Модуль управления питанием (PMC) с режимами пониженного энергопотребления (Wait, Stop).

3. Электромеханические характеристики:

  • Корпус: LQFP-48 (7x7 мм).
  • Напряжение питания: 2.7В — 5.5В (широкий диапазон, совместимый с 3.3В и 5В логикой).
  • Диапазон температур: Промышленный (-40°C до +85°C).
  • Количество линий ввода-вывода (GPIO): До 40 (зависит от конфигурации альтернативных функций).

Парт-номера (Part Numbers) и корпуса

Основная часть номера MCF51AC128CCLKE расшифровывается так:

  • MCF51AC128: Семейство и модель (ColdFire V1, 128 КБ флеш).
  • C: Вариант температуры (промышленный, -40°C to +85°C).
  • CLKE: Код корпуса и варианта поставки.
    • CLK: Обозначает корпус LQFP-48.
    • E: Вариант упаковки (обычно лента и катушка для автоматического монтажа).

Альтернативные парт-номера в этом семействе (могут отличаться объемом памяти, периферией или корпусом):

  • MCF51AC128CLLK (LQFP-32, 8 КБ RAM) - другой корпус, меньше линий I/O.
  • MCF51AC128BLLK (LQFP-32, 4 КБ RAM) - меньше RAM.
  • MCF51AC64CLLK (LQFP-32, 64 КБ флеш, 4 КБ RAM).
  • MCF51AC256CLLK (LQFP-32, 256 КБ флеш, 16 КБ RAM).

Совместимые и аналогичные модели

1. Прямые аналоги от NXP (последующие поколения): После интеграции Freescale в NXP, семейство MCF51AC/AG было переименовано и стало основой для серий:

  • Kinetis EA Series (Kinetis EA MKE02): Это прямой наследник и рекомендуемая замена. Микроконтроллеры MKE02Z64VLD2 (LQFP-32, 64 КБ) или MKE02Z128VLK2 (LQFP-32, 128 КБ) обладают схожей периферией, лучшей производительностью (ядра ARM Cortex-M0+), большей экосистемой и активной поддержкой. Для корпуса LQFP-48 можно смотреть на MKE02Z128VLC2. Это наиболее актуальные и доступные аналоги на сегодня.
  • Kinetis L Series (KL1, KL2): Более ранняя серия на Cortex-M0+, также подходящая для апгрейда, но EA Series более близка по периферии и позиционированию.

2. Совместимые по выводам и функционалу (Drop-in Replacement): Полного "дроп-ин" аналога с идентичной распиновкой может не существовать из-за смены ядра. Однако:

  • MCF51AC128CLLK (LQFP-32) и другие из того же семейства имеют совместимость по коду (ядро то же) и частично по выводам.
  • Для перехода на Kinetis EA потребуется переработка печатной платы и миграция кода (с ColdFire на ARM Cortex-M0+), хотя NXP предоставляет инструменты для облегчения миграции.

3. Аналоги от других производителей (по классу и применению):

  • Microchip (Atmel) AVR UC3C / SAM C/D (на ядре ARM Cortex-M0+).
  • STMicroelectronics STM32F0 Series (Cortex-M0).
  • Infineon XMC1000 Series (Cortex-M0).
  • Renesas RL78/G1F (проприетарное 16-битное ядро).

Важное примечание:

Семейство MCF51AC/AG и конкретно MCF51AC128CCLKE находятся в состоянии "Not Recommended for New Designs" (NRND) или "End of Life" (EOL). Это означает, что для новых проектов настоятельно рекомендуется использовать современные аналоги из серии NXP Kinetis EA (MKE02). Они предлагают лучшую производительность, энергоэффективность, более современные инструменты разработки и долгосрочную доступность.

Резюме: MCF51AC128CCLKE — это мощный 8/32-битный МК своего времени, который сегодня успешно заменяется на микроконтроллеры NXP Kinetis EA Series на ядре ARM Cortex-M0+.

Товары из этой же категории